GDB GDB is a text-debugger common to most Linux systems. For remote debugging, we'll run gdbserver on the target, and the cross-debugger (gdb-multiarch) on the host.1. Build your project using the -g option to ensure the file gets debug symbols. • This likely means adding the -g option to your CFLAGS variable in your Makefile. 2.

Valgrind is a sophisticated utility for finding low-level programming errors, particularly involving memory use. " how to make a logo on kritaWebWhen the program is not running as a process, start it with GDB: $ gdb program Replace program with a file name or path to the program. GDB sets up to start execution of the program. You can set up breakpoints and the gdb environment before beginning the execution of the process with the run command.
